Serif Humanist Pige 4 is a regular weight, narrow, medium contrast, upright, normal x-height font.

This typeface presents a compact old-style serif look with subtly uneven, calligraphic stroke endings and lightly bracketed serifs that often resolve into wedge-like terminals. Strokes show moderate modulation and a slightly rough, inked edge quality, giving forms a textured, handmade rhythm rather than a polished, mechanical finish. Counters are generally open and the curves are gently organic; capitals feel slightly irregular in silhouette, while lowercase maintains a steady text rhythm with distinctive, flicked terminals on letters like a, c, e, and s. Numerals share the same chiseled/inked construction, with slightly quirky proportions that keep the set cohesive with the letters.

Well-suited for book covers, chapter titles, pull quotes, and editorial headlines where a historical, handcrafted voice is desirable. It can also work for branding and packaging that aims for an old-world or artisanal impression, and for short passages of display text where its textured rhythm can be appreciated.

The overall tone is warm and historical, evoking printed ephemera, early book typography, and hand-rendered lettering. Its small irregularities and tapered endings add a human presence that can feel literary and slightly whimsical while still reading as serious and traditional.

The design appears intended to reinterpret old-style serif construction through a lightly distressed, calligraphy-influenced drawing, prioritizing warmth and individuality over strict regularity. It aims to deliver a period flavor and a tactile, ink-on-paper feel while remaining broadly legible in display and short text settings.

In running text, the narrow proportions and lively terminals create a busy, animated texture; it benefits from comfortable sizing and spacing so the textured edges don’t crowd. The font’s character comes through strongly in capitals and in high-frequency shapes (e, s, r), which adds personality but makes it feel less neutral than a typical text face.
